I had a phone call to the PIPS helpdesk yesterday due to some password problems.
After the nice support lady patiently fixed my problems I asked here about the rumours I heard.
Q: Is it true that PIPS is in very bad shape and that everything is going to collapse?
Her answer: No, PIPS is in very good shape and besides, do you think that anybody would be here to answer your questions if we were near to collapse?
Q: Is it true that Gary N. and Elsabeth R. and several other senior consultants have quit their jobs in PIPS/Picpay?
Her answer: Yes some of our employees have quit their jobs because they have gotten better offers from other companies.
Q: Is it true that there will be a major restructuring of the PIPS 2% model?
Her answer: No, the PIPS 2 % model will remain as it is now.
Q: A lot of members, included me, are very worried for our funds, since there have been nearly no payouts for 7 months. Will there be any solution to this in the near future?
Her answer: Yes, we are working hard to solve this situation and Brian, Sir, will come with an update in the members area as soon as it is established.
By the way, last week I bought a new PIPS account. The member ID number was above 750 000 :o
